Enhanced Recovery and Postoperative Analgesia After Laparoscopic Myomectomy: A Randomized Controlled Trial Comparing
Chunrong Zeng1, Guoxu Ling1, Caitao Huang1
1Department of Anesthesiology, People's Hospital of Guangxi Zhuang Autonomous Region, Nanning, Guangxi, People's Republic of China.
Objective:
This study compares the effects of total intravenous anesthesia (TIVA, Group A), general anesthesia combined with transversus abdominis plane block and rectus sheath block (TAPB+RSB, Group B), and general anesthesia combined with quadratus lumborum block at the lateral supra-arcuate ligament (QLB-LSAL, Group C) on postoperative pain and recovery in patients undergoing laparoscopic myomectomy.
Methods:
This was a prospective, single-center, randomized controlled trial involving 120 patients (1:1:1 randomization). The primary outcome was the visual analog scale (VAS) score for oxytocin-induced uterine contraction pain at 24 hours postoperatively (T16). Secondary outcomes included postoperative analgesic efficacy, intraoperative anesthetic consumption, hemodynamics, recovery indicators, and adverse reactions.
Results:
Group C exhibited significantly lower oxytocin-induced contraction VAS scores than Groups B and A, with Group B also lower than A (all P<0.05). Postoperatively, Group C had the lowest resting/exercise VAS scores, analgesic pump presses, and rescue analgesia needs within 48 hours (P<0.05). Intraoperatively, Group C required the least propofol, remifentanil, and sufentanil, demonstrated superior hemodynamic stability, faster recovery/extubation, shorter PACU stays, better muscle strength, and higher QoR-15 scores (all P<0.05). PONV incidence was lower in Group C than A (P<0.05). No significant differences were found in patient demographics, operative/hospitalization time, or sleep quality, and no major block-related complications occurred.
Conclusion:
General anesthesia combined with QLB-LSAL can effectively alleviate postoperative uterine contraction pain, reduce the need for anesthetic drugs during and after surgery, promote early recovery, and does not increase the risk of complications, making it an optimized anesthesia protocol for laparoscopic myomectomy.
